Commit graph

36 commits

Author SHA1 Message Date
github-actions[bot]
e85b28ffa6 flake.lock: Update
Flake lock file updates:

• Updated input 'ghostty':
    'github:ghostty-org/ghostty/b1af4a597f359491f4b3197a845b39ec86db475a?narHash=sha256-ygRFvCVdVEAU95tH2EMMacYH/T42tC3mtDkt5lBJT9U%3D' (2025-05-16)
  → 'github:ghostty-org/ghostty/af293830f35658ad5430bc09677d7e658ffdc1a7?narHash=sha256-Lgp1GtjNff8JRjpcJntYUy%2BFWypKwfwwnXli0Ohu7Eo%3D' (2025-05-19)
• Updated input 'sops-nix':
    'github:Mic92/sops-nix/e93ee1d900ad264d65e9701a5c6f895683433386?narHash=sha256-PxrrSFLaC7YuItShxmYbMgSuFFuwxBB%2Bqsl9BZUnRvg%3D' (2025-05-05)
  → 'github:Mic92/sops-nix/8d215e1c981be3aa37e47aeabd4e61bb069548fd?narHash=sha256-lAblXm0VwifYCJ/ILPXJwlz0qNY07DDYdLD%2B9H%2BWc8o%3D' (2025-05-18)
2025-05-19 16:37:50 +00:00
Jo
ede0cfa32b Add youtube-music package and update flake inputs (gnome 48 wohoo)
Some checks failed
update-dependencies / update-dependencies (push) Has been cancelled
2025-05-19 00:14:38 +02:00
Jo
8d739f8c4c Add some new packages and update Zed formatter config 2025-05-18 21:54:20 +02:00
Jo
e06d8be50a ♻️💄 Cleanup and Theme updates
Some checks failed
update-dependencies / update-dependencies (push) Has been cancelled
2025-04-22 23:54:14 +02:00
github-actions[bot]
0af6fcda3f flake.lock: Update
Flake lock file updates:

• Updated input 'catppuccin':
    'github:catppuccin/nix/5e303e8d7e251868fa79f83bbda69da90aa62402?narHash=sha256-xr6ntmiUPXSh9o9mJ7og9vxALMQs1EQhIhWUAO2D1M0%3D' (2025-03-21)
  → 'github:catppuccin/nix/c41c89f69fcdc8bd78bbc95123eef280575f1df8?narHash=sha256-S9Q/Pl0U/kdwz8LBt1JjE1Qay3CY0pk1gHHvRosWlUI%3D' (2025-03-29)
• Updated input 'ghostty':
    'github:ghostty-org/ghostty/bcff4e18f430e0e34412f631215f196c9e0c885b?narHash=sha256-sBbZcxiiv4BYBU/PdpqYZcG8HTu5BTMsRKqv2celzEQ%3D' (2025-03-25)
  → 'github:ghostty-org/ghostty/1067cd3d8a061eb5b23bc1a4c46ca10af4481941?narHash=sha256-LrQd2IkfcmHdBh%2BpwPEPXzcosBerIEFzz/DbVNzBqig%3D' (2025-03-28)
• Updated input 'hardware':
    'github:NixOS/nixos-hardware/ecaa2d911e77c265c2a5bac8b583c40b0f151726?narHash=sha256-zvQ4GsCJT6MTOzPKLmlFyM%2Blxo0JGQ0cSFaZSACmWfY%3D' (2025-03-24)
  → 'github:NixOS/nixos-hardware/0ed819e708af17bfc4bbc63ee080ef308a24aa42?narHash=sha256-I09SrXIO0UdyBFfh0fxDq5WnCDg8XKmZ1HQbaXzMA1k%3D' (2025-03-28)
• Updated input 'home-manager':
    'github:nix-community/home-manager/f565da89e759ebf57b236510aa955b8a2d41c779?narHash=sha256-OrLDssbhEZvbHMljgT2mFNWacghm2HJBDTWlqTJNhO8%3D' (2025-03-25)
  → 'github:nix-community/home-manager/b431496538b0e294fbe44a1441b24ae8195c63f0?narHash=sha256-G7866vbO5jgqMcYJzgbxej40O6mBGQMGt6gM0himjoA%3D' (2025-03-29)
• Updated input 'nixpkgs':
    'github:nixos/nixpkgs/1750f3c1c89488e2ffdd47cab9d05454dddfb734?narHash=sha256-oDJGK1UMArK52vcW9S5S2apeec4rbfNELgc50LqiPNs%3D' (2025-03-24)
  → 'github:nixos/nixpkgs/6c5963357f3c1c840201eda129a99d455074db04?narHash=sha256-yQugdVfi316qUfqzN8JMaA2vixl%2B45GxNm4oUfXlbgw%3D' (2025-03-27)
2025-03-29 17:27:38 +00:00
Jo
2ae1a63dcd Migrate Vesktop install to Nixcord configuration and add
AnnotationMono font
2025-03-29 18:21:13 +01:00
Jo
e826f17c22 👷🚧 Add "update-dependencies" workflow 2025-03-26 09:18:07 +01:00
Jo
de5c068d60 Enable Mutter dynamic tripple buffering patch 2025-03-18 02:58:14 +01:00
Jo
3958d51e78 ♻️ Add Wakatime config and reorganize some files 2025-03-17 23:32:59 +01:00
Jo
8e37d6e64f add new wallpapers, back to fish and syntax changes 2025-02-22 17:46:38 +01:00
Jo
24fff4ee33 add nushell and vscodium configurations 2025-02-09 23:52:24 +01:00
Jo
18337ad778 🔥 remove elonmoc2 module due to errors 2025-01-31 01:06:56 +01:00
Jo
26915606dd (systems/puzzlevision) add support for fingerprint scanner 04f3:0c00 2025-01-20 18:23:20 +01:00
Jo
5087472710 update gnome config, add ghostty, last commit of v1 2025-01-09 17:48:09 +01:00
Jo
ad97764694 feat: add cachix configuration 2024-12-23 18:30:07 +01:00
Jo
a5b583f43a feat(puzzlevision): add zen browser and remove firefox
feat: implement super basic Yubikey configuration
2024-12-14 00:45:35 +01:00
Jo
a45e263617 feat: partially configure VSCodium 2024-11-14 22:47:48 +01:00
Jo
9737568dd9 fix(service/bluesky): forward host headers to PDS through traefik
fix(service/bluesky): update PDS URL
2024-10-29 02:11:21 +01:00
Jo
3cd04be672 feat(modules): add new GTK styles to Catppuccin config
fix(modules): update vaultwarden service hostname usage

feat(flake): add sops-nix to flake

feat: add .sops.yaml base, not quite ready just yet
2024-09-22 03:11:14 +02:00
Jo
0c1476ce83 refactor(module): apply gnome wallpaper in catppuccin theme config 2024-09-10 10:50:23 +02:00
Jo
fde4abd59d refactor(module): clean up some module inputs
feat(module): add use-lix option to nix module

feat(module): update fish config for catppuccin
2024-09-10 10:46:16 +02:00
Jo
067bc992b6 feat: add zed-editor wrapped in FHS compliant environment
feat: various other tweaks
2024-09-02 18:57:59 +02:00
Jo
32ab43f7dd [modules] add plasma nixos module, modify gnome nixos module
feat(modules): add plasma module
refactor(module): gnome module has to be explicitly enabled now
2024-07-31 01:15:24 +02:00
Jo
742706fe0f Ready to kms at this point. Will fix the remaining issues later.
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-07-23 09:15:53 +02:00
Jo
23635a9bda remove old config
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-07-23 02:12:34 +02:00
Jo
ce89240d04 fix: repair GTK theme and gnome-shell theme
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-07-03 08:28:12 +02:00
Jo
674e20233b [general, networking] use rtl8821ce driver for bluetooth stuttering fix, enable flatpak, more
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-06-06 12:22:10 +02:00
Jo
ae474de92e [general] add missing shell theme config to gnome
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-05-29 14:00:31 +02:00
Jo
fbba93c16a [general] add gnome config, de-clutter puzzlevision system config
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-05-29 00:15:32 +02:00
Jo
339bd28d1d [general] add work and gaming user, tweak configs
feat: added new ssh configuration modules for home-manager

feat: add user work with configurations for my work environment

feat: added gaming user with configuration for my gaming enviornment eg. lutris and steam
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-05-20 18:08:16 +02:00
Jo
cff1ca5701 [general] further improve immutability of KDE config
feat: add resources directory
feat: update KDE config
refactor: remove unused files
2024-05-14 01:34:04 +02:00
Jo
bbe6ab62c4 refactor: clean up files and remove unecessary comments
Signed-off-by: Jo <johannesreckers2006@gmail.com>
2024-05-12 22:36:58 +02:00
Jo
39dd3f47c8 We do a little refactoring + plasma theming 2024-04-25 02:33:53 +02:00
Jo
05b36550a3 push changes 2023-11-19 23:12:39 +01:00
Jo
5b7d0b0a49 refactoring some stuff 2023-10-25 12:12:59 +02:00
Jo
d7b67b87da Initial commit 2023-10-23 00:28:18 +02:00